[edit]DescriptionP-40Fs 66th FS take off in North Africa c1942.jpg | Two U.S. Army Air Forces Curtiss P-40F Warhawk fighters of the 66th Fighter Squadron take off on a mission over North Africa. The 66th FS was assigned to the U.S. Army Middle East Force in Egypt in July 1942, becoming part of IX Fighter Command. It took part in the British Western Desert Campaign from the Battle of El Alamein to the Axis defeat in Tunisia in May 1943. |
